Hello Facilities Desk,

Starting Monday, the loading dock at Thornquist House will accept deliveries only between 07:00 and 11:30 on weekdays. Couriers arriving outside that window should be redirected to the holding bay on Level B1, and the front desk must be notified so we can log the exception. Please brief the weekend crew as well, since Saturday deliveries are suspended entirely. For after-hours dock checks, staff should use the door pass listed below.

Best,
Front Desk, Thornquist House

turnstile pass: bdg-QZV-3

# Heads up, future maintainer: this env file drives the Crashbucket pipeline
# for the Lumenlark mobile app. Reports land in the intake queue, get
# symbolicated by the Dustrake workers, then ship to the dashboard.
# Don't touch the queue names unless you also update the workers, or
# reports silently vanish. The intake service needs an auth secret to
# accept uploads, and it lives on the very next line.

sealed setting: ARCHIVE_KEY3=8d0

Subject: Second-Source Supplier Hunt — Quick Update

Hi all,

Quick one: the search for a backup supplier on the Pellor valve line is down to two candidates, Varenda Metals and Castwick Forge. Site visits wrap next week. Please hold any new single-source commitments until then. Context on why this matters right now is in the note below.

board note of bawep-tajef: Queniusek Systems plans to raise the Quenvan list price by 53.1 percent in March. The pricing group signed off on a budget of $176.4 million for Project Drueth. The renewal with Casionix Partners closes at $142.5 million a year, 8.3 percent below the last contract. Project Fraax slips by six weeks because of the tooling delay.